SUMMARY
The Physical Therapist Case Manager, Home Care provides Physical Therapy Services; providing assessments,
service plan development and supervision of care as provided by Home Care program staff.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ES
a. Coordinate with physicians and appropriate personnel regarding changes in needs or conditions, instructing Home Care staff as directly related to the plan of care. Develop individualized care plans, establishing goals based on therapy diagnosis and incorporate therapeutic, preventive, and rehabilitative actions. Includes the patient and the family in the planning process.
b. Identify discharge planning needs as part of the care plan development, facilitating coordination of client services with other providers as required.

JOB SPECIFICATIONS
Education, Experience and Credentials
·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ited school in Physical Therapy required.
· Must be licensed with the State of Minnesota as a Physical Therapist and must maintain license.
· CPR/First Aid certified through American Red Cross required.
· Two or more years of previous related experience in a similar position and in a similar care environment preferred.
· Valid Minnesota drivers’ license with good driving record, and proof of valid insurance and/or have
reliable transportation.

WORK ENVIRONMENT
The work environment is indoors, occasional exposure to the outdoors and inclement weather when traveling between sites. May be at risk of exposure to blood, bodily fluids, and other potentially infectious material. Conditions can vary greatly, as a majority of work is done in client homes.
